Toyota Kirloskar Motor (TKM) has launched its Environment Month 2025 campaign under the theme “Sustainable Resource Management Drive,” blending corporate responsibility with human impact. Embracing ‘Zero-Base Thinking’ and the 4Rs—Refuse, Recycle, Reuse, and Reduce—the initiative aims to nurture a culture of sustainability through grassroots engagement and forward-thinking innovation.
With milestones like 100% renewable electricity in operations, 96% waste recyclability, and nearly 90% water reuse, TKM’s journey over 25 years has been one of transformation. Its 25-acre ‘Ecozone’ has educated over 42,000 students and stakeholders, instilling environmental values in young minds. The “TKM Sustainable Hub 2025” will host community-focused events such as Green Expos, student-led upcycling projects, and clean technology showcases.
